Micro Python is a lean and fast implementation of the Python 3 programming language that is optimised to run on a microcontroller. The Micro Python board is a small electronic circuit board that runs the Micro Python language.
Micro Python has been successfully funded via a Kickstarter campaign. The software is now available to the public under the MIT open source license, and the boards are due for delivery in March 2014.
